The quandary of the younger sister - what to do when it had already been done.
For as long as Lucy can remember, she's been caught between loyalty to her rootless, idealistic mother and devotion to her fierce and exacting sister, Bea. But as the sisters come of age and embark on their own experiments - in love, drugs, work, motherhood - they find their lives, and their relationships, increasingly in turmoil. Can their love for each other transcend the damages of the past?
